Cymbals belong to the percussion family of instruments. They are classified as unpitched percussion instruments, meaning they do not produce a definite pitch but rather create a loud, crashing sound when struck. Typically made of metal alloys, cymbals are often used in orchestras, bands, and various musical genres to provide rhythm and accentuation.

Assorted percussion instruments belong to the percussion family of musical instruments. This family is characterized by instruments that produce sound when struck, shaken, or scraped. Assorted percussion typically includes a variety of instruments such as tambourines, maracas, cymbals, and drums, each contributing unique timbres and rhythms to musical compositions.
